🤎 Financial Responsibility in Pet Ownership: Planning for Your Cat’s Rainy Day

You don’t need to be rich to give a cat a wonderful life. What truly matters is being prepared. Accidents and surprises have a way of showing up quickly, and sometimes at the worst possible time. A little planning now can make a big difference later when your cat needs you most.

Here are a few simple ways to stay ready for those unexpected moments:

The Profit First Approach (Cat Edition)

Open a small savings account just for your cat. Every time you get paid, tuck away 1 to 3 percent of your paycheck. It may not sound like much, but it grows faster than you’d think. Treat it like your cat’s personal safety net, and give it a playful name that makes you smile, like “The Meowney Jar.”

Pet Insurance

Pet insurance is one a great tool to help you handle surprise vet costs. Take a little time to compare plans and find one that fits your budget and your cat’s needs. The right plan can bring peace of mind knowing you’ll be able to give your cat the care they deserve when it matters most.

Have a “Mexico Plan” Ready

Keeper and Cat Mexican Border

If you live close enough or can travel, Mexico can be an affordable option for quality veterinary care. It helps to plan ahead so you know where to go, how to get there, and what paperwork you’ll need. To learn more, visit our guide on Vet Visits in Mexico: Essential Advice for Pet Owners.
